Biography

 

Cheryl is inspired to paint by the colour, structure and form of all botanical and natural history subjects. Her aim is to represent and respond to what she sees in contemporary and beautiful watercolour images.

 

After qualifying in Scientific and Natural History Illustration from Blackpool College, Cheryl worked for several years as a successful freelance Illustrator working with leading Artists Agent ‘The Garden Studio’, producing illustrations for use in publishing and advertising for clients which included: Country Living, Tesco, Sainsbury, Marshall Cavendish, Ward Lock and Times Books. 

 

Throughout this time she also worked as a freelance finished artist for a company specialising in the area of thematic cartography, working on many of The Times Thematic atlases before ultimately being given the task of creating new and amending existing artworks for Times Atlas of World History (4th Edition) and Times Concise Atlas of World History. She qualified as a teacher in adult education in 1993. 

 

Shortly after this she lived for two years in Zaragoza in Spain and took a career break to have children. She returned to teaching in 2002 and turned professional (again) in 2006 and now works from home where she has spent recent years developing her style and exploring further the technical aspects of watercolour painting. Cheryl now exhibits and sells her work locally in Derbyshire and nationally, tutors in adult education and runs workshops privately and for local groups and organisations. 

 

Awards:

 

She was awarded the St Cuthbert’s Mill Award by the SBA in 2009 and a Silver-Gilt medal by the RHS in 2010.
